Surface Tension s (Liquid/Gas)
- DEFAULT: PPDS 14: (Output details)
s/so = a0 × ta1 ×(1 + a2 × t) , where t = 1 - T/Tc and Tc is the critical temperature, and so = 1 N/m.
- Alternative 1: Yaws.SurfaceTension (Output details)
s/so = exp(A)×{1 - ( T / Tc )}n, where so = 1 N/m
- Alternative 2: Watson (Output details)
ln(s/so) = a1 + åai ×Tri-1 ×ln(1-Tr) , where the summation is from i = 2 to nTerms -1
Tr = T/Tc, Tc is the critical temperature, and so = 1 N/m
- Alternative 3: ISTExpansion (Output details)
s/so = åai ×(1 - T/Tc)i, where the summation is from i = 1 to nTerms, and so = 1 N/m
